Understanding the Mechanics of Chance
At the heart of any casino game – and especially those found within a luck casino – lies the concept of chance. This isn't simply about random outcomes, however. It’s a sophisticated interplay of probability, algorithms, and, in some cases, skill. For instance, slot machines utilize Random Number Generators (RNGs) to ensure each spin is independent of the last, guaranteeing a fair and unpredictable result. These RNGs are continuously audited by independent testing agencies to verify their integrity and prevent manipulation. The “luck” element isn’t about controlling the outcome, but about understanding the probabilities involved. Different slot games have different Return to Player (RTP) percentages, indicating the theoretical amount of money returned to players over time. A higher RTP generally suggests a more favorable outcome for the player, although it doesn’t guarantee individual wins.
The Role of Algorithms and Fair Play
Beyond slot machines, table games also rely on algorithms to simulate real-world casino scenarios. In online blackjack, for example, the dealer's actions are determined by pre-programmed rules, ensuring consistency and fairness. However, unlike slots, blackjack incorporates an element of skill, where players can make strategic decisions to influence their odds. Understanding basic strategy – knowing when to hit, stand, double down, or split – can significantly improve a player’s chances of success. Reputable online casinos employ robust security measures, including encryption technology and fraud prevention systems, to protect player data and ensure fair play. Licensing and regulation by respected authorities, such as the Malta Gaming Authority or the UK Gambling Commission, provide an additional layer of assurance for players.
| Game Type | Typical House Edge | Skill Factor |
|---|---|---|
| Slot Machines | 2-10% | Low |
| Blackjack (basic strategy) | 0.5-1% | High |
| Roulette (European) | 2.7% | Low |
| Baccarat | 1.06% (Banker bet) | Low |
This table showcases the diverse house edges across a selection of common casino games, alongside an indication of the skill level required to optimize a player’s chances. It’s important to remember that the house edge represents the casino’s average profit over the long term, and individual results will vary.
Navigating the World of Online Casino Bonuses
One of the most attractive features of online casinos is the availability of bonuses and promotions. These can range from welcome bonuses for new players to reload bonuses for existing customers, as well as free spins, cashback offers, and loyalty programs. These incentives are designed to attract players and encourage continued engagement. However, it's important to understand the terms and conditions associated with these bonuses before claiming them. Many bonuses come with wagering requirements, which dictate how much money a player must wager before being able to withdraw any winnings. For example, a bonus with a 30x wagering requirement means that a player must wager 30 times the bonus amount before being eligible for a withdrawal. Understanding these requirements is crucial to avoid disappointment and ensure a positive gaming experience.
Understanding Wagering Requirements and Game Contributions
Wagering requirements aren’t the only factor to consider. Different games contribute varying percentages towards fulfilling these requirements. Typically, slot games contribute 100%, meaning that the full amount wagered counts towards the requirement. However, table games like blackjack and roulette may only contribute a smaller percentage, such as 10% or 20%, due to their lower house edge. Carefully reviewing the game contributions is essential to determine how efficiently a bonus can be cleared. Furthermore, some bonuses may have maximum bet limits, restricting the amount a player can wager per round. Failing to adhere to these terms and conditions can result in the forfeiture of the bonus and any associated winnings. Responsible players carefully analyze these details before accepting any promotional offer.

Responsible Gaming Practices in the Digital Age
The convenience and accessibility of online gambling can also pose risks, particularly for vulnerable individuals. It’s vital to practice responsible gaming habits to ensure that gaming remains a fun and entertaining pastime, rather than a source of financial or emotional distress. Setting limits on both time and money spent is a critical step. Many online casinos offer tools to help players manage their spending, such as deposit limits, loss limits, and self-exclusion options. Deposit limits allow players to restrict the amount of money they can deposit into their account within a specific time period, while loss limits cap the amount of money they can lose. Self-exclusion allows players to voluntarily ban themselves from accessing the casino for a predetermined period. Recognizing the signs of problem gambling, such as chasing losses, gambling with money needed for essential expenses, or experiencing feelings of guilt or shame, is equally important.

Exploring Gaming Regulations and Licensing Frameworks
The legal framework surrounding online casinos is complex and varies significantly across different jurisdictions. Reputable online casinos operate under licenses issued by respected regulatory bodies, which impose strict standards for fairness, security, and responsible gaming. These licenses serve as a guarantee to players that the casino is legitimate and adheres to industry best practices. Understanding the different licensing jurisdictions and their respective requirements is vital for discerning trustworthy operators from rogue casinos. For example, the Malta Gaming Authority (MGA) is renowned for its rigorous licensing process and high standards of player protection. The UK Gambling Commission (UKGC) is another highly respected regulator, known for its stringent enforcement of responsible gaming measures. Players should always verify that a casino holds a valid license from a reputable jurisdiction before depositing any funds.
Furthermore, it’s crucial to be aware of the legal implications of online gambling in your own jurisdiction. Some countries have fully legalized and regulated online casinos, while others impose restrictions or outright bans. Engaging in illegal online gambling activities can carry significant penalties, including fines and even imprisonment. Always familiarize yourself with the local laws and regulations before participating in any online gaming activities.
